2001 Pontiac Bonneville review from North America
"This car is doing well for it's age"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Mirror cover on visor flap does not close properly.
Drink holder basically holds one drink rather than two.
Wipers were not reliable, problems in winter.
Factory installed battery gave out 1st year.
Leather seat wear not as expected.
Exhaust pipe fumes burned through bumper.
Wind noise excessive at 65 mph.
General comments?
I love this car :)
Usual repairs, I like good brakes at all times.
Finish is beautiful.
Comfortable ride, good hwy gas mileage for it's size.
Back seat ride not bad at all say parents.
Excellent interior lighting, easy on the eyes at night.
AC excellent. Heating OK.
Excellent handling. Fun to drive.
